In Event: Science Instructional Interventions: Influences on Science Content and Scientific Thinking
Previous studies report that narratives work best to scaffold model-based learning environments when they present a familiar entry point into the content-to-be-learned, as well as a common ground for discussion and engagement. We highlight another essential characteristic of effective narratives: They must generate a motive or a need to know. Generating motive may be accomplished through problematizing, or casting doubt on students' perceptions that they already know why a specific, otherwise familiar, phenomenon occurs. Findings from a study conducted at three public schools in New York City indicate that the introduction of problematization into a narrative lead to better learning outcomes and increased interactions with our diffusion simulation, compared with a non-problematizing version. Implications and next steps are discussed.
